We investigate the properties of the spectral function A(ω,U) of correlated electrons within the Hubbard model and dynamical mean-field theory. Curves of A(ω,U) versus ω for different values of the interaction U are found to intersect near the band-edges of the non-interacting system. For a wide range of U the crossing points are located within a sharply confined region. The precise location of these “isosbestic points” depends on details of the non-interacting band structure. Isosbestic points of dynamic quantities therefore provide valuable insights into microscopic energy scales of correlated systems.
